I’ve been painting portraits since I got my first iPad in 2010. I used to use pastels and watercolors as well as charcoals and pen and ink very early on. So the iPad reignited my interest in painting. Creating artwork digitally offers a variety of options. So I opened an Etsy shop in 2012 and have done a lot of custom pet portraits. Then I thought I could use these images on other websites. So I uploaded them to Fine Art America/Pixels, and opened shops on Zazzle, Redbubble, and Amazon Merch. And I have my own website called LITDigitalArt and Such that combines all of these things. I enjoy painting a custom piece, but it is exciting to learn when someone purchases an image that is available on line. I get email notifications when something sells, except on Amazon I need to check my stats to see if anything is bought. So yesterday I checked and noticed that a black lab pullover hoodie was selected. A couple of hours later Redbubble sent me an email that an American Eskie sticker was sold. It’s certainly not the commission I get that’s attractive - it’s the idea that someone noticed and liked something I painted enough to purchase it. There are millions of images out there.
